Emacsのインデントについて質問です。配列などを複数行に渡って記述する際、下のページの例のように『開き括弧¥n インデント1つ 内容¥n インデントなしで閉じ括弧』と字下げするにはどのような設定をすればよいのでしょうか。Emacs 21.3.1のcperl-modeを使っています。

http://d.hatena.ne.jp/wanpark/20050302#hatena

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:
  • 終了:--
※ 有料アンケート・ポイント付き質問機能は2023年2月28日に終了しました。

回答1件)

id:Debian_GNU No.1

回答回数24ベストアンサー獲得回数0

ポイント40pt

複数行を選択して

M-x indent region

で、どうでしょうか。

id:wanpark

indent-region は選択範囲を普段のやり方で字下げするコマンドのようです。期待通りの結果は得られませんでした。

ご紹介のマニュアルにもこれといった項目がないので、Lispで何か書かなくてはいけないのでしょうか。そうなると素人の私には難しい……。

2005/03/06 01:33:26

コメントはまだありません

この質問への反応(ブックマークコメント)

トラックバック

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

回答リクエストを送信したユーザーはいません